Cosy double room with king size bed in Kilnamanagh Dublin 24

Clean and cosy double room on the first floor with generous king size bed accommodated by a friendly couple and a child (who live in the same house) in a quiet neighbourhood of Kilnamanagh with lots of greenfields around and a short stroll to Tymon Park; free parking; short walk to the tram (Kingswood stop - 10 mins) and buses (27, 77A - 7 mins) and Kilnamanagh Dunnestore shopping centre (12 mins); 5 mins drive to M50, N81 for fast commuting in Dublin or intercities; 6 mins drive to TU Tallaght; 8 mins drive to the Square Shopping Centre Tallaght and Tallaght Hospital
